  • First Trimester Screening

    What is a First Trimester Screening? A first trimester screening performed roughly between 11-13 weeks of pregnancy is used to detect chromosomal abnormalities such as Down's Syndrome, Edwards' Syndrome, and Patau's Syndrome.
